"Self-Referral Physiotherapy"

About: North Manchester General Hospital

Initially went to GP. Was given the phone no’ for self-referral. Simple, straightforward process. Was seen within a few days. Friendly informal dept. Was happy with exercise & ‘homework’. Attended once a wk, then 2wkly & finally once a month for approx 8mths.

Also received several courses of Acupuncture during physio sessions.

I have also had a referral to PARS. My physio sessions have now finished. But, My file has been left open if I should need to return in the future.. Via self-referral process.

I had a good relationship with my assigned physiotherapist.I am content with the complete service I received. Thank You. Regards, EF.
